How much does commercial cleaning cost?


Commercial cleaning costs vary, depending on the size of the job and how often you want the cleaning service to come. You can decide to be charged by the hour or charged a flat rate per visit.


The starting rate for commercial cleaning for Milton's Finest Cleaning Service is $32/hour. However, reoccurring visits can get you a better price for commercial cleaning. Cleaners can work around your schedule so you never have to worry about interrupting business operations or getting in the way of customers while we’re cleaning.


It is recommended that businesses schedule at least two visits a week to keep their workspace free from germs and to have a healthy environment. The general rule is that the more often you have cleaners come in, the lower the cost per visit.
